Electronic signatures used within U.S. nonprofit CLM systems are generally enforceable under ESIGN and UETA, provided intent, consent, and association of signature with the record are documented.

Nonprofit staff across programs, finance, development, and operations commonly interact with contract lifecycle systems to create, review, and store agreements.
Volunteers and external partners may also sign or receive documents, while admins manage templates, permissions, and retention settings to maintain compliance.

Two-way integration allowing creation and sending of documents from Google Docs and automatic saving of signed PDFs back to Drive, maintaining folder structure and access controls for team collaboration.
Native or connector-based links to CRMs such as Salesforce enable auto-population of contact and organization data, tracking signed agreements as related records for donor and partner management.
Direct links to Dropbox and OneDrive for storing executed contracts in designated folders with retention and backup policies aligned to organizational recordkeeping practices.
Template library supports preapproved language, role-based placeholders, and merge fields to ensure consistent, compliant contracts across programs and funders.

Most modern CLM and eSignature platforms run in browsers and provide native mobile apps, ensuring access on desktop, tablet, and phone where connectivity allows.
For field teams, mobile apps and responsive signing are critical; ensure browsers meet security standards, enable TLS, and verify mobile OS compatibility. Confirm device storage and backup policies, and require PIN or biometrics for app access where available to protect sensitive donor and volunteer information.
